Scope and content
File consists of a program and recording of the concert.
Performers: University Women's Chorus ; Robert Cooper, conductor ; Mia Bach, accompanist ; The Oriana Singers ; William Brown, conductor ; James Bourne, accompanist ; Ashley Simkiw, soprano
Program:
- Angelus ad virginem / arr. Paul Halley
- Come, ye makers of song / Ruth Watson Henderson
- Laudate dominum / Egil Hovland
- Lift thine eyes / Felix Mendelssohn
- Quant J'ai ouy le tabourin / William Brown
- Cantate domino / Gyongyosi Levente
- Pie Jesu / Robert Evans
- Psalm 23 / Z. Randall Stroope
- Ave Maria / Gustav Holst
- Freedom trilogy / Paul Halley
- Ave Maria / Francis Poulenc
- A la musique / Emmanuel Chabrier
- Rose trilogy / Eleanor Daley
- A city called heaven / arr. Josephine Poelnitz
- Ride on, King Jesus / Moses Hogan.
